Meralco announces Friday, April 10, a hike of P0.5335 per kilowatt-hour in electricity rates this April. It says this is largely due to the weakening of the peso against the US dollar.

00:00The Manila Electric Company or Meralco announces Friday, April 10, a hike of more than 53 centavos
00:07per kilowatt hour this April. It says this is largely due to the weakening of the peso against
00:11the U.S. dollar. These adjustments have yet to reflect fuel price increases due to the Middle
00:16East conflict. Meantime, Energy Secretary Sharon Garin says her department suspended rules to
00:22lessen electricity production dependence on expensive fuels and increase the sources of
00:26renewable energy. She continues to call on Filipinos to conserve energy to make sure
00:31there will be no shortage.
